Payments from the IRA account will attract a 15% non-resident withholding tax at source e.g. $1,500. This IRA payment will be fully taxable in Canada at 20% = $2,000. However, you will receive a foreign tax credit for any US taxes paid, e.g. 1,500. Therefore your net payment on the IRA payment in Canada will be $500 ($2,000 less $1,500) Total ...

When it comes to navigating the complex world of commercial real estate, having a knowledgeable and experien...US Trusts are not beneficial to Canadian residents. Having a US trust while a resident in Canada isn’t a good idea. From a Canadian tax perspective, the trust is likely considered a Canadian resident trust because the trustees are now Canadian residents. Meaning you will have to file a T3 tax return. It can also cause double taxation.Dec 22, 2022 · Fortunately, this 30% is reduced to 15% thanks to a tax treaty shared by Canada and the United States. This flat commission fee presently makes CIBC Investor’s Edge among the cheapest Canadian bank-owned brokerages.Around 20 years ago Canadian and US security regulators got together and created rules saying residents of one country can't use brokerage accounts in the other country. There were some exceptions made for special accounts such as RRSPs, but since you just have a normal taxable account the exceptions likely don't apply to you.
